About 3,4-dimethyl-2-propan-2-yl-2H-1,3-thiazole

3,4-dimethyl-2-propan-2-yl-2H-1,3-thiazole (PubChem CID 154535860) has the molecular formula C8H15NS and a molecular weight of 157.28 g/mol. Its IUPAC name is 3,4-dimethyl-2-propan-2-yl-2H-1,3-thiazole.
